New from NANNP: Impact of APRN Shift Length and Fatigue

The Impact of Advanced Practice Registered Nurses' Shift Length and Fatigue on Patient Safety presents recommendations based on current evidence, recommendations from governing bodies, and the NANNP workforce surveys. 

NANNP recognizes that fatigue, sleep deprivation, and the extended shift lengths or hours that neonatal nurse practitioners often work present potential safety risks for patients, providers, and employers. Based on a review of current evidence, recommendations from governing bodies, and the NANNP workforce surveys, recommendations were formulated for the NNP regarding education, fatigue management, and systems management. NANNP recognizes further research is needed for the NNP role and various scope of practice, as well as fatigue management, patient safety, and job satisfaction.
